Output 8ef7b7b17762fc26d4ba7c56b489ad5463ea427e5395123380500c0fd57d8ba5:0

value
29260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d15ff51ca52fe773c13edcb9aeece54e7d16f50 OP_EQUAL
address
3D6QjvaoNuw6FGqdHqH79aT2xXx5hZQ5QF
transaction
8ef7b7b17762fc26d4ba7c56b489ad5463ea427e5395123380500c0fd57d8ba5
spent
true